Roasted Asparagus with Balsamic Browned Butter
source: Cooking Light, September 2001
40 asparagus spears, trimmed (about 2 pounds)
Cooking spray
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1/8 teaspoon black pepper
2 tablespoons butter
2 teaspoons soy sauce (low-sodium)
1 teaspoon balsamic vinegar
Preheat oven to 400˚.
Prep tip: Pick up one asparagus spear and snap it. Line up this spear with the rest and cut to that length.
Arrange the asparagus in a single layer on a baking sheet. Coat with cooking spray.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. Bake for 12 minutes or until tender.
In a small skillet over medium heat, cook for 3 minutes or until lightly browned, shaking pan occasionally. Watch carefully; do not burn butter. Remove from heat. Stir in soy sauce and balsamic vinegar. (Careful! The sauce bubbles up ferociously. I always quickly place a splatter screen over the skillet. Learned this the hard way.)
Drizzle sauce over the asparagus, tossing well to coat. Serve immediately.
